
The fuel consumption per 100 kilometers for the KAROQ is 5.9 liters. The fuel consumption per 100 kilometers refers to the fuel consumption of a vehicle traveling a certain speed on the road for 100 kilometers, which is a theoretical indicator of the vehicle. Taking the 2021 Comfort Edition KAROQ as an example, its body structure is a five-door, five-seat SUV, with body dimensions of: length 4432mm, width 1841mm, height 1614mm, a wheelbase of 2688mm, a fuel tank capacity of 51 liters, and a curb weight of 1380kg. The 2021 Comfort Edition KAROQ features a front suspension in the form of MacPherson independent suspension and a rear suspension in the form of a torsion beam non-independent suspension. It is equipped with a 1.4T turbocharged engine, delivering a maximum horsepower of 150 PS, a maximum power of 110 kW, and a maximum torque of 250 Nm, paired with a 7-speed dual-clutch transmission.

Having driven the KAROQ for over two years, my daily fuel consumption typically ranges between 7.5 to 8.5 liters per 100 kilometers. In city traffic jams, it can easily spike to 9 liters, while on highways it drops to just over 6 liters at its lowest. This car is quite worry-free with its responsive engine, but frequent aggressive throttle starts or using sport mode will definitely increase fuel consumption.
